Core Skills Analysis
English
- The student learned about storytelling structure and plot development through interactive decision-making in the game.
- Critical thinking skills were enhanced as the student had to anticipate consequences of their choices in the narrative.
- Vocabulary and language skills were expanded through exposure to varied dialogues and text within the game.
- The game promoted creativity and imagination as the student had to actively engage in shaping the narrative outcome.
Tips
To further develop language skills post-activity, encourage the student to write their own short stories or alternate endings to existing narratives. Utilize creative prompts and encourage active reading of diverse genres to enhance vocabulary and storytelling abilities.
